Bridgewater’s Risk-Managed AllWeather Strategy
Bridgewater Associates, the world's largest hedge fund, is renowned for its pioneering investment strategies. Among its most celebrated creations is the AllWeather Portfolio, a diversified strategy designed to mitigate risk and generate consistent returns across broad market conditions. This portfolio's principle is rooted in the belief that market movements are inherently unpredictable, and thus requires an investment model that can withstand turbulence.
The AllWeather Portfolio achieves this goal by allocating assets across distinct asset classes, including stocks, bonds, commodities, and non-traditional assets, each chosen for its distinct traits in varying market conditions. This strategic diversification helps to insulate the portfolio from the full impact of any single market downturn.
Furthermore, the AllWeather Portfolio employs a rigorous risk oversight framework to identify and gauge potential threats, allowing for proactive adjustments to maintain an optimal risk-return ratio. This data-driven approach allows Bridgewater to navigate market volatility with precision, striving to deliver consistent returns regardless of the prevailing market outlook.
Evergreen Guidance by Warren Buffett
{Warren Buffett, the legendary investor, has disclosed invaluable insights over his decades-long career. His wisdom continues to stimulate investors of all levels, providing timeless lessons that transcend market fluctuations. Buffett emphasizes the importance of basic analysis, focusing on a company's earnings. He urges long-term holding strategies, avoiding short-term speculation and championing market volatility. One of Buffett's most well-known principles is the concept of a margin of safety, pointing out the need to purchase assets at a discount to their intrinsic value. He argues that patience and discipline are crucial for success in investing, persuading investors to avoid emotional choices. Buffett's legacy is founded on his unwavering commitment to ethical behavior, building trust with stakeholders and developing long-term value creation.
